WebNov 20, 2006 · Here, we report a novel green-emitting phosphor suitable as a color conversion material for white LEDs. The phosphor is comprised of an oxide host crystal and a lanthanide activator. The host crystal has a garnet structure with the composition of . The activator is Ce ion.
